Easy Diy Guide: Removing A Plastic Faucet Stem Step-By-Step

how to remove a plastic faucet stem

Removing a plastic faucet stem can seem daunting, but with the right tools and approach, it’s a manageable DIY task. Begin by shutting off the water supply to the faucet to avoid leaks or spills. Next, disassemble the faucet handle by removing any screws or caps covering the stem. Use a pair of pliers or a faucet puller to grip the stem firmly and turn it counterclockwise to loosen it. If the stem is stuck due to mineral buildup or corrosion, apply penetrating oil and let it sit for a few minutes before attempting removal again. Once the stem is free, inspect it for damage and replace it if necessary, ensuring a proper fit to prevent future leaks.

Characteristics Values
Tools Required Adjustable wrench, pliers, screwdriver, penetrating oil (e.g., WD-40), replacement stem (if needed)
Preparation Turn off water supply, open faucet to relieve pressure, place a bucket under the faucet to catch water
Step 1 Locate and remove the screw cover (often a cap or button) on the faucet handle using a screwdriver
Step 2 Remove the handle screw and lift off the handle
Step 3 Expose the plastic faucet stem by removing any retaining nuts or collars with an adjustable wrench or pliers
Step 4 Apply penetrating oil to the stem if it’s stuck or corroded, let it sit for 10-15 minutes
Step 5 Grip the stem firmly with pliers or a wrench and turn counterclockwise to unscrew it
Step 6 If the stem is broken or stuck, use a stem puller tool or carefully extract it with pliers
Step 7 Clean the area and inspect for damage; replace the stem if necessary
Step 8 Reassemble the faucet by reversing the steps, ensuring all parts are securely tightened
Safety Tips Wear safety goggles, avoid excessive force to prevent damage to the faucet body
Common Issues Corrosion, stripped threads, broken stems, stuck parts due to mineral buildup
Replacement Ensure the new stem matches the original in size and type (e.g., quarter-turn, cartridge)

Shut Off Water: Locate shut-off valves under the sink and turn them clockwise

Before you begin the process of removing a plastic faucet stem, it is crucial to shut off the water supply to the faucet to prevent any unwanted spills or leaks. This step is essential for a smooth and mess-free repair or replacement. Start by locating the shut-off valves under your sink. These valves are typically found on the water supply lines that connect to the faucet. Most sinks have separate valves for hot and cold water, usually positioned on the wall or the back of the cabinet, directly beneath the sink basin. Identifying these valves is the first step in ensuring a dry and safe working environment.

Once you've located the shut-off valves, you'll need to turn them off to stop the water flow. The standard operation for these valves is to turn them clockwise to close. Grab the valve handles firmly and rotate them in a clockwise direction. You might need to apply some force, especially if they haven't been used in a while. It's important to turn both the hot and cold water valves to ensure the faucet is completely isolated from the water supply. This action will prevent any water from flowing through the faucet during the repair process.

In some cases, you might encounter different types of shut-off valves, such as ball valves or gate valves. Ball valves have a handle that you turn 90 degrees to shut off the water, while gate valves typically have a round knob that you turn multiple times. Regardless of the type, the principle remains the same: turn the valve in the closing direction (clockwise for most) until it stops. If you're unsure about the type of valve you have, a quick online search or consultation with a plumber can provide clarity.

After turning the valves, it's a good practice to test the faucet to ensure the water is indeed shut off. Simply open the faucet to see if any water flows out. If the valves were successfully closed, the faucet should not release any water. This confirmation step is vital to avoid any surprises when you start working on the faucet stem. If water still flows, double-check the valves and ensure they are fully closed.

Disassemble Faucet: Remove handle, escutcheon, and retaining nut carefully

To begin disassembling your faucet and remove the plastic stem, start by focusing on the handle. Most faucet handles are secured with a screw located either on top or underneath a decorative cap. Use a screwdriver to remove this screw, taking care not to strip it. Once the screw is out, gently lift or pull the handle away from the faucet body. If the handle feels stuck, avoid forcing it; instead, use a handle puller tool to prevent damage to the handle or the stem beneath it. With the handle removed, you’ll expose the next components that need to be addressed.

Next, turn your attention to the escutcheon, which is the decorative plate or cover surrounding the faucet. In some cases, the escutcheon may be held in place by screws or simply friction-fitted. If there are screws, remove them carefully using a screwdriver. If it’s friction-fitted, gently pry it loose using a flathead screwdriver or a putty knife, taking care not to scratch the finish. Once the escutcheon is removed, you’ll have better access to the retaining nut and the plastic faucet stem.

With the escutcheon out of the way, locate the retaining nut that holds the stem in place. This nut is typically found directly beneath the handle and escutcheon. Use an adjustable wrench or pliers to grip the retaining nut firmly, ensuring you have a good hold to avoid slipping. Turn the nut counterclockwise to loosen and remove it. Be cautious not to apply excessive force, as this could damage the plastic stem or surrounding components. If the nut is difficult to turn, consider using penetrating oil to loosen it before attempting again.

After removing the retaining nut, inspect the area for any additional components, such as O-rings or washers, that may need to be carefully set aside for reassembly. At this point, the plastic faucet stem should be exposed and ready for removal. Gently pull the stem straight up and out of the faucet body. If it feels stuck, avoid twisting or forcing it, as plastic stems can break easily. Instead, use a stem removal tool or gently wiggle it back and forth while pulling upward to free it from the faucet assembly.

Throughout this process, it’s crucial to work methodically and patiently, especially when dealing with plastic components that can be brittle. Keep track of the order in which parts are removed and any screws or small components, as this will make reassembly much easier. Replace or Repair: Install a new stem or repair the old one if possible

When deciding whether to replace or repair a plastic faucet stem, start by assessing the condition of the existing stem. Plastic stems are prone to cracking, warping, or stripping over time, especially in areas with hard water or frequent use. If the stem is visibly damaged, corroded, or no longer functions properly (e.g., leaks or won’t turn), replacement is often the best option. However, if the damage is minor, such as a small crack or surface wear, you may be able to repair it temporarily using epoxy or a repair kit designed for plastic components. Always consider the age of the faucet and the availability of replacement parts before proceeding.

To install a new stem, begin by shutting off the water supply to the faucet and opening the valve to release any residual water. Disassemble the faucet handle by removing the screw cover and loosening the screw that holds the handle in place. Lift the handle off and set it aside. Next, use a wrench or pliers to carefully remove the retaining nut that secures the stem. Once the nut is removed, gently pull the stem out of the faucet body. Take note of the stem’s orientation and any washers or O-rings that may need to be transferred to the new stem. Insert the new stem, ensuring it is aligned correctly, and reattach the retaining nut. Reassemble the handle and test the faucet for leaks.

If you choose to repair the old stem, start by cleaning the area around the damage to ensure a proper bond for any repair material. For small cracks or holes, apply a plastic-compatible epoxy or adhesive, following the manufacturer’s instructions. Allow the repair material to cure fully before reassembling the faucet. For stripped threads, consider using a thread repair kit or wrapping the stem with Teflon tape to improve the seal. Keep in mind that repairs are often temporary, and repeated issues may indicate the need for a full replacement.

Before finalizing your decision, weigh the cost and effort of repairing versus replacing. Replacement stems are relatively inexpensive and provide a long-term solution, while repairs may save money in the short term but could fail if the stem is too damaged. Additionally, consider the overall condition of the faucet—if other components are worn or outdated, replacing the entire faucet might be more practical.
